function isNAMEOFVOCATIONUWANT(cid)
return isInArray({vocation id, vocation promo id (if u have one)}, getPlayerVocation(cid))
function onSay(cid, words, param)
if getPlayerGroupId(cid) >= 4 then
if param ~= "" then
local commapos = string.find(param,",")
local name = string.sub(param,1,commapos-1)
local int = string.sub(param,commapos+1,string.len(param))
local player= getPlayerByName(name)
doPlayerSendCancel(cid, name .. " has been set to vocation id " .. int .. "")
doPlayerSetVocation(player, int)
function isnecromancer(cid)
return isInArray({vocation 13, vocation promo id (if u have one)}, getPlayerVocation(cid))
end
end
end
end
<vocation id="13" name="Necromancer" description="a warlock" needpremium="0" gaincap="18" gainhp="23" gainmana=17" gainhpticks="8" gainhpamount="10" gainmanaticks="4" gainmanaamount="10" manamultiplier="1.5" attackspeed="700" soulmax="200" gainsoulticks="15" fromvoc="13" lessloss="50">
<formula meleeDamage="1.0" distDamage="1.0" wandDamage="1.0" magDamage="1.0" magHealingDamage="1.0" defense="1.0" armor="1.0"/>
<skill id="0" multiplier="1.5"/>
<skill id="1" multiplier="2.0"/>
<skill id="2" multiplier="2.0"/>
<skill id="3" multiplier="2.0"/>
<skill id="4" multiplier="2.0"/>
<skill id="5" multiplier="1.5"/>
<skill id="6" multiplier="1.1"/>
</vocation>